Add new dynamic rows in existing table in power bi.

I have a table in which i have sales and type of the sales along with date. After each week i want to calculate the average of last 8 weeks and dynamically add new row with the average as sales and "Forecast" as the type.

Is it possible in power bi?

@unaseerb ,

 

I'm afraid power bi can't dynamic add rows of average values. Power bi only support add measures/calculate columns which can be changed dynamically with the data source. 

 

In your senario, I would suggest you write a trigger in database.
